`
zengjinliang
  • 浏览: 301634 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

JAVA閏年判斷

阅读更多
方法1:
int year = 2008;
boolean falg = false;
if(year%4!=0){    
  falg=false;
}else if(year%100!=0){   
  falg=true;
}else if(year%400!=0){
	falg=false;   
}else{
falg=true;
}	    

if(falg==true){
  System.out.println("是閏年");
}else{
  System.out.println("不是閏年");
}

方法2:
Calendar calendar = Calendar.getInstance();
boolean b = ((GregorianCalendar)calendar).isLeapYear(year);
if(b==true){
  System.out.println("是閏年");
}else{
  System.out.println("不是閏年");
}




分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ics